Minutes — Management Meeting, Brindlecore Ltd.

Attendees: dept heads. Chair: M. Vessler.

Agenda: launch of the Polaris tier for the Quillstack platform. Pricing approved at last week's steering call. Marketing to finalize messaging by Friday. Support confirmed staffing for rollout. Engineering flagged billing migration risk; mitigation owned by T. Okabe. Launch date holds.

Actions: heads to confirm readiness by Thursday. Next review in two weeks. The following note is restricted to attendees only.

board note of fafog-yahap: Project Rusdor slips by a full year because of the audit delay.

### RBAC for Wrenwiki
Roles: reader, editor, steward. Permissions resolve per-namespace, cached per session. Cache invalidates on role change via the event bus; worst-case staleness bounded by TTL. Stewards bypass cache for audit views. No inheritance across namespaces — keep it flat, it has bitten us before. Page-level overrides are denied-by-default. Cache sizing and TTL behaviour are controlled by the constants listed below.

tuning table, yajog-yahof:
BUDGETS = {
    "lamvan": 303,
    "wenox": 460,
    "fenvan": 525,
}

## Add nightly rate-parity sweep for Lumenstay

This PR adds a scheduled job that compares our published rates against the three resale feeds Lumenstay ingests. Mismatches beyond the tolerance band are written to the parity_alerts table and surfaced in the Brightdesk dashboard. The comparison normalizes currency and tax-inclusive pricing before diffing, so small rounding drift no longer triggers false alarms. Retries use exponential backoff and respect each feed's rate limits. The job's behavior is governed by the tuning constants below.

limits module of fajog-tawig:
RATE_LIMITS = {
    "druwyn": 2,
    "quenael": 10,
    "wenix": 2,
    "druael": 2,
}

## Releases

Staticshift ships weekly. Incremental rebuild manifests are generated per release and pushed to the Corvane artifact store. New team members: run the rebuild diff check before tagging, confirm stale-page detection passes, and never publish an unsigned manifest — the edge nodes drop them. Release tags follow calendar versioning. Verification happens automatically on pull; signing happens at tag time. The deploy key used for signing release manifests is shown below.

signing key of kahog-kadup = bky13_6wLyxnPsJob4P